ROLE OF BRAIN INTERSTITIAL ADENOSINE IN HYPOXIC VENTILATORY DEPRESSION

英文摘要
The purpose of this study is to elucidate the time-dependent change of endogenous adenosine levels in the brain during moderate sustained hypoxia, and to examine its possible relationship with the ventilatory depression seen in the latter falf of sustained hypoxia. In 10 spontaneously breathing cats (carotid sinus and vagal nerve intact), the interstitial levels of adenosine were estimated by a microdialysis method in frontal cortex and nucleus tractus solitarius (NTS) before and during 40 min isocapnic hypoxia (mean PaO2 = 38.3 Torr). The adenosine levels reversibly increased during hypoxia both in the cortex (from 0.70 (〕SY.+-.〔) 0.10 SE to 1.09 (〕SY.+-.〔) 0.13 muM, P <0.05) and in the NTS (from 0.53 (〕SY.+-.〔) 0.08 to 0.95 (〕SY.+-.〔) 0.19 muM, P <0.05) without a significant difference between the two regions. There was a significant positive correlation between the relative rise of adenosine only in the NTS and the relative decline of ventilation after its peak during sustained hypoxia(r=0.70, P<0.05), which may support the hypothesis that the interstitial adenosine in the medulla is involved in the development of hypoxic ventilatory depression in cats.
